When I first got these shoes last August, I loved them! They fit my feet perfectly and were very comfortable (and still are). However, my complaint is that only after wearing them a couple of months, the mesh fabric on the top and sides (particularly on the left shoe) has started ripping in multiple locations and now is so bad I am embarrassed to wear them anywhere else besides going outside walking. I have no idea why this is happening, I primarily only wear the shoes for a couple hours a day to take my dog on walks and occasionally run some errands. This has never happened to me with any other pair of sneakers that I have bought so unfortunately I will not purchase another pair of ASICS for this reason as the quality of the shoe is not good to withstand over time, especially for the price point.

I generally supinate and when I walked/ran in these shoes in the house I felt like the shape of the shoe was causing my foot to move sideways towards the outside in a way that didn't feel natural to my gait. I have high arches and have had plantar fasciitis. This was one of the shoes recommended for those conditions. Shoe felt wonderfully padded and I would have gone with it otherwise. I went with the Brooks Ghost 14 (also recommended for my conditions) instead even though it didn't feel as cushy as this one. It's all a very personal choice.

I have worn Asics Gel Nimbus for many years as my go to walking/athletic shoe. It was a lifesaver for me when I had plantar fasciitis in 2012. I have tried to get a new pair the last few years and the last few iterations just did not work for me. The cushion had changed and toe box seemed shorter and overall the shoe more narrow. One of my feet measures as a B width and the other a C width so I have been looking at a women's D shoe. I have had to go up another 1/2 size as the shoes seems to be cut shorter than the older styles. I bought this pair of Nimbus and chose the mens shoe regular width as it just felt a little better than the women's D width. What I like: The cushion and arch support even though I think the gel feel is far less than say 3 versions ago. What I don't like: The way the tongue is sewn in. Not nearly as soft and comfortable as the loose tongue. I preferred the split cushion where the achilles tendon comes down to the heal. Much more comfortable. The shoe still feels a bit snug and considering trying the men's wide to see if the toe box is more comfortable and wish the toe box was a bit taller. I spent a long time at the shoe store trying different brands. I still think my nimbus gel 18 had the best all round shoe cushion for comfort on the upper as well as the sole. I just get the feeling the shoe has been scaled back or cheapened compared to former versions. Looking at several other brands but in the end the arch support in this shoe really fits mine the best. Sad to pay 150 + for a shoe and feel like I am making do.
